In this episode of Somos Sunnyside, Superintendent Gastelum visits Sunnyside High School’s Film & TV program with teacher Nick Duddleston and student Marisela Wilson to explore how students are gaining hands-on experience in broadcast journalism, film, video, and live media production. This dynamic program prepares students for careers in the Radio, TV, and Film industries, equipping them with technical skills and real-world opportunities.
From producing Blue Devil News to filming public service announcements and community events, including graduation, these talented students are mastering storytelling through media. Tune in to hear how Sunnyside’s Film & TV program is shaping the next generation of media professionals!
